The journey begins at 681 Chinle Dr in Kanab, Utah, where a knowledgeable guide will meet your group. From there, an exciting 4WD ride takes you into the heart of the canyon area. This isn’t just any vehicle—think rugged, off-road capable, designed to maneuver through the challenging, dusty terrain that standard cars simply can’t handle. The ride itself is often described as “quite an adventure,” with reviews emphasizing how much fun the ride adds to the overall experience.
This off-road segment is a highlight for many travelers who appreciate the thrill of a bit of adventure even before reaching the main attraction. The guides are praised for their safety skills and for making the ride enjoyable rather than nerve-wracking. Expect the scenery along the way to be just as captivating as the canyon itself, with plenty of opportunities for photos of the rugged landscape.
Once at the canyon, your guide will encourage you to explore freely. The canyon’s slender passages and layered sandstone walls are what set this spot apart. With colors ranging from dusty reds and earthy browns to burnt oranges, these formations are as mesmerizing as they are photogenic. Many travelers comment on how difficult it is to capture the full beauty of the scene—so bring your camera, and don’t be shy about taking your time.
One of the strengths of this tour is the educational component. Guides share insights about how the canyon was formed and its geological significance. The layered sandstone tells a story of natural processes playing out over millions of years, and your guide’s explanations add depth to what might otherwise be just an Instagram-worthy moment.
The total tour lasts about 1 hour and 30 minutes, which strikes a good balance—long enough to explore thoroughly but not so long that it becomes tiring. The group size is kept small, enhancing the personalized feel. Travelers have noted that there’s plenty of time to take photos and enjoy the scenery without feeling rushed.

How long does the tour last?
The tour lasts approximately 1 hour and 30 minutes, making it a manageable outing without feeling rushed or overly long.
What is included in the tour?
The tour includes a private guided exploration, a ride in a rugged 4WD vehicle, and bottled water. It’s all about giving you a comfortable, informative, and scenic experience.
Is this tour suitable for children or families?
While most travelers can participate, the rugged 4WD ride might be a consideration for families with very young children or those sensitive to bumpy rides. Check with the provider if you have concerns.
How far in advance should I book?
Most people book around 42 days ahead, especially during peak times. Booking early ensures you secure a spot, as the tour is popular.
What is the meeting point?
The meeting point is at 681 Chinle Dr, Kanab, Utah. The guide will meet you there to start the adventure.
Are gratuities included?
No, gratuities are not included but are appreciated if you feel the guide provided exceptional service.
Can service animals participate?
Yes, service animals are allowed on the tour.
What weather conditions might affect the tour?
The experience requires good weather. In case of poor weather, the tour may be canceled or rescheduled, and you’ll be offered a different date or a full refund.
